About Willow River State Park

Willow River State Park near Hudson, Wisconsin is a small ski area operating at 933 feet elevation with 223 feet of vertical drop. The modest terrain makes it a local option for skiers and snowboarders in the region, though the vertical and setting reflect a community-focused hill rather than a destination resort. Winter conditions and snow reliability depend on Wisconsin's typical lake-effect and regional systems; check conditions before planning a visit, as operations can be weather-dependent at smaller areas.
